Low Volume Prototype Production: Smart Scaling

What is low volume prototype production? It’s 10–500 unit runs. Perfect for market testing. Avoids mass-production tooling traps.

Cost-Saving Perks

  • Skip $50k+ injection molds
  • Test demand risk-free
  • Iterate between batches

Prototype Services for Startups: Launch Faster, Spend Less

Startups need affordability and mentorship. Not corporate pricing tiers. Rapid prototyping fundamentals.

Must-Have Features

  • DFM coaching: Avoid unmanufacturable designs
  • Modular pricing: Pay per iteration
  • IP protection: Guard your invention

Vendor Selection: Your Transactional Checklist

Cut through marketing fluff. Compare apples-to-apples.

CriteriaWhat to AskResearch Insight
Capabilities“Can you machine Inconel 718?”FOW Mould: Seek flexible manufacturing
Speed“What’s 50-unit SLS timeline?”Protolabs: 1-day quotes set the standard
Support“Do you provide DFM reports?”Outdesign Co: Mentorship accelerates ROI
Costs“Show setup fees breakdown”WayKen: Scalable pricing prevents shocks
